dc.description.abstract Vacuum membrane distillation technique is employed to purify industrial waste water. This technique is a very handy solution to the current water challenges. The feed water enters the test section from one side and evaporates. The vapors than pass through a hydrophobic membrane to the permeate side. The driving force is vacuum pressure generated by vacuum pump on the permeate side. Mathematical modelling is conducted to know the effects of temperature, feed velocity and pressure difference.
